Android/IOS/WP/Symbian
东子哥7
这个作者很懒,什么都没留下…
展开
-
ReactNative问题集锦
1、BitIteratorDetail.h:21:10: boost/iterator/iterator_adaptor.hpp' file not found #include 原因:react-native run-ios或者打开.xcodeproj编译时,boost无法下载完整(原因你知道的)解决:单独下载boost包, /***/项目文件夹/node_modules/react-n原创 2017-11-01 18:04:54 · 400 阅读 · 0 评论 -
Android开发:ListView加上滚动滑块
如果在listview上加上一个滑块,这样方便滚动只需在listview的布局属性加上 android:fastScrollEnabled="true" 即可<listview android:id="@+id/listView" android:layout_width="fill_parent" android:layout_height="fill_paren原创 2013-07-11 14:18:40 · 2063 阅读 · 0 评论 -
Android开发: listview去除分割线
通过布局的android:dividerHeight="" 和 android:divider="" 来实现去除分割线,不是太方便而且还会受背景影响。下面的方法最简便lvMain = (ListView)view.findViewById(R.id.list_bookcontent);lvMain.setDivider(null);//去除listview的下划线来自东子哥的原创 2013-08-12 17:01:54 · 10514 阅读 · 0 评论 -
IOS开发:apple.com上无法下载xcode
昨晚要更新下载xcode,出现下列情况,到现在还未更新完?找到了 其他下载点http://dl.dbank.com/c0hwtj6amv原创 2013-07-29 08:56:32 · 1162 阅读 · 0 评论 -
Android开发:ContentProvider学习
1.什么是ContentProvider 数据库在Android当中是私有的,当然这些数据包括文件数据和数据库数据以及一些其他类型的数据。 不能将数据库设为WORLD_READABLE,每个数据库都只能创建它的包访问, 这意味着只有由创建数据库的进程可访问它。如果需要在进程间传递数据, 则可以使用AIDL/Binder或创建一个ContentProvider,但是不能跨越进程/包边转载 2013-08-08 14:59:42 · 953 阅读 · 0 评论 -
Android开发:Android Studio发布
谷歌在前几天的开发者大会发布了安卓的开发环境Android Studio。有许多令人期待的特性出现基于 Gradle 的构建支持 (PS: 网络状态不好的话,初次新建项目会因为下载gradle超时而失败,多尝试几个就是了)Android 专属的重构和快速修复提示工具以捕获性能、可用性、版本兼容性等问题支持 ProGuard 和应用签名基于模板的向导来生成常用的 Android原创 2013-05-18 01:04:51 · 1269 阅读 · 0 评论 -
Android开发:service服务里获得屏幕信息
service服务里获得屏幕信息,如屏幕的长宽 DisplayMetricsdm = new DisplayMetrics(); dm =getResources().getDisplayMetrics(); int screenWidth =dm.widthPixels; int screenHeight =dm.heightPixels;原创 2013-07-01 08:48:22 · 1586 阅读 · 0 评论 -
Android开发:日期格式化
显示月份及星期几 TextView tvDate = (TextView) view.findViewById(R.id.tv_date); df = new SimpleDateFormat("M月d日 EEEE"); tvDate.setText(df.format(date));来自东子哥的Blog海峡移动开发技术群:13734312原创 2013-07-05 08:39:09 · 1079 阅读 · 0 评论 -
Android开发:在外部存储卡上生成文件
如何在外部存储卡上动态生成文件 if(Environment.getExternalStorageState().equals(Environment.MEDIA_MOUNTED)){ File sdCardDir = Environment.getExternalStorageDirectory();//获取SDCard目录 String ExportFilePath = sdC原创 2013-06-19 17:57:44 · 1811 阅读 · 0 评论 -
Android开发:ListView加上长按事件
为ListView加上长按事件 lvMain.setOnItemLongClickListener(new OnItemLongClickListener() { @Override public boolean onItemLongClick(AdapterView parent, View view, int position, long id) { //原创 2013-07-14 10:23:39 · 3028 阅读 · 0 评论 -
Android开发:TextView添加超链接的简便方法
TextView中加入超链接的方式很多,但下面的方式应该的最简便合理的strings.xml中定义字串string name="blog">a href="http://blog.csdn.net/jonahzheng">东子的博客a>布局中textview定义,并且textview的text引用stings.xml中定义的‘blog’ TextView原创 2013-06-19 11:28:24 · 8862 阅读 · 0 评论 -
IOS开发:xcode5版本引发的问题
下面这段代码是用于处理ios7头部透明问题的#if __IPHONE_OS_VERSION_MAX_ALLOWED >= 70000if ( IOS7_OR_LATER ){self.edgesForExtendedLayout = UIRectEdgeNone;self.extendedLayoutIncludesOpaqueBars = NO;self.modalPresen原创 2013-09-17 00:13:43 · 2847 阅读 · 2 评论 -
IOS开发:IOS7下Statusbar出现透明及界面下方出现空白
步骤1、在ViewController中 loadView#if __IPHONE_OS_VERSION_MAX_ALLOWED >= 70000if ( IOS7_OR_LATER ){self.edgesForExtendedLayout = UIRectEdgeNone;self.extendedLayoutIncludesOpaqueBars = NO;self.modal原创 2013-09-24 11:13:06 · 8538 阅读 · 2 评论 -
Delphi移动开发:打开一个网址
IOS下usesPosix.Stdlib;procedure TForm1.btnStartClick(Sender: TObject);begin _system(PAnsiChar('open http://127.0.0.1:8001'));end;uses Apple.Utils;procedure TForm2.btnStartClick(Se原创 2013-10-12 20:03:21 · 2714 阅读 · 0 评论 -
新浪微博登录提示"sso package or sign error"的原因及解决
整合微博分享,添加新浪微博时,原创 2014-10-05 17:01:06 · 47116 阅读 · 3 评论 -
ITouch在xcode下提示‘No such file or directory, at ‘/SourceCache/DVTi...'
用一个台老ITouch进行真机调试时,xcode无法认到,换不同版本的xcode也不行,且在organizer中提示No such file or directory, at ‘/SourceCache/DVTiOSFrameworks/DVTiOSFrameworks-5053/DTDeviceKitBase/DTDeviceKitBase_Utilities.m:1572’原创 2014-07-11 11:44:55 · 2574 阅读 · 0 评论 -
关于Android NDK
转载自 http://blog.csdn.net/hhao137/archive/2009/06/28/4304664.aspx1、前言 6月26日,GoogleAndroid发布了NDK,引起了很多发人员的兴趣。NDK全称:Native DevelopmentKit。下载地址为:http://developer.android.com/sdk/ndk/1.5_r1/index.html。原创 2013-09-27 23:14:53 · 792 阅读 · 0 评论 -
NodeJs 高效的新奇的Web解决方案
这两天研究Node.js,对一技术方案实在着迷。官网:http://nodejs.org/1.NodeJS是一个使用了Google高性能V8 引擎的服务器端JavaScript实现。它提供了一个(几乎)完全非阻塞I/O栈,与JavaScript提供的闭包和匿名函数相结合,使之成为编写高吞吐量网络服务程序的优秀平台。2.Node.js都被说用于服务器端的的JavaScript,很容易误认原创 2013-09-27 23:15:05 · 1506 阅读 · 0 评论 -
IOS开发:发布APP提交完成后的提示
提示info.plist的APP版本的设置与ITunes Connect中的所对应APP的版本不一致,这样可能会影响到APP的审核。原创 2013-09-27 22:46:36 · 1260 阅读 · 0 评论 -
启动Android 4.0模拟器提示的错误
今天通过AVD Manager无法创建成功关于Android 4.0的Virtual Device, 提示'Unable tofind a 'userdata.img' file for ABI armeabi to copy into the AVDfolder. '的错误,查了一下帮助发现,Android 4.0以上的模拟器需要ARM EABI SystemImage的支持,通过And原创 2013-09-27 23:14:57 · 907 阅读 · 0 评论 -
Unicode和UTF-8之间的转换详解
分享自http://hi.baidu.com/dustin_xiao 通过这几天的研究,终于明白了Unicode和UTF-8之间编码的区别。Unicode是一个字符集,而UTF-8是Unicode的其中一种,Unicode是定长的都为双字节,而UTF-8是可变的,对于汉字来说Unicode占有的字节比UTF-8占用的字节少1个字节。Unicode为双字节,而UTF-8中汉字占三个字节。转载 2013-09-27 23:14:51 · 11739 阅读 · 0 评论 -
FireMonkey开发: 图片缩放
图片缩放FM的TBitmap增加了CreateThumbnailhttp://docwiki.embarcadero.com/Libraries/XE2/en/FMX.Types.TBitmap.CreateThumbnailTBitmap.CreateThumbnail(200,200);原创 2013-08-13 17:49:49 · 3510 阅读 · 0 评论 -
IOS开发:XCode5中显示行号
xcode->preferences->text editing->editing第一个项 show line numbers打勾既可。原创 2013-09-07 18:20:03 · 7841 阅读 · 0 评论 -
Android开发:TextView加入滚动条
利用scrollview来实现,效果会好很多 <ScrollView android:id="@+id/scrollView1" android:layout_width="match_parent" android:layout_height="150dp" android:fa原创 2013-05-09 17:54:39 · 866 阅读 · 0 评论 -
Android开发:TextView换行
很简单用转移符 “\n” TextView tvEESource = (TextView) dialog_equipment.findViewById(R.id.ee_source); tvEESource.setText("AAA\nBBB\nCCC");原创 2013-05-09 15:30:45 · 1578 阅读 · 0 评论 -
Windows 8开发31历程---第一天: 一个的空白应用程序
译者注: 最近对Html5相关的内容及Windows 8开发产生了浓厚的兴趣,故尝试翻译Clark Sell的《31 Days of Windows 8 for Html5》,因本人英文水平有限,翻译未能达意之处,请大家尽量点处。 在本系列的第一篇文章中,我认为全面的介绍 Visual Studio 2012中 Windows Store Blank App templ翻译 2012-12-24 13:03:39 · 2425 阅读 · 1 评论 -
Android开发: 如何基于Android for X86开发应用
观看转载 2012-11-20 17:50:20 · 892 阅读 · 0 评论 -
Android开发: 在Android虚拟设备中使用SDCard及问题分析
一.为Android虚拟设备添加SDCard1.打开AVDM,选择要一个虚拟设备2.选择Edit,编辑一个AVD,在SD Card栏中,Size中输入SDCard的大小100(或者file中选择一个sdcard的img文件),点击Edit AVD关闭窗口,这样就可以在C:\Documents and Settings\Administrator\.android\avd\And原创 2012-11-07 09:54:40 · 2752 阅读 · 3 评论 -
WP8开发: Win8 风格图标收集
第一套图标下载地址第二套图标下载地址第三套图标下载地址待续中....来自东子的博客原创 2012-11-09 12:05:37 · 2478 阅读 · 0 评论 -
WP8开发: Windows Phone 7.X 与 Windows Phone 8 的区别
微软先前发布 Windows Phone 8 操作系统时,曾经承诺现有的 Windows Phone 可以升级到 WP7.8 这个版本;不过 Windows Phone 7.8 大家知道除了支持可自定大小的动态砖首页以外,它与 WP8 的差异在哪里似乎不是讲得很清楚。 而最近法国网站 Smartphone France 号称拿到诺基亚的内部文件,里面写明了 Windows Phone 7转载 2012-11-07 16:05:28 · 1423 阅读 · 0 评论 -
Android开发: 离线安装ADT出现的问题
Eclipse 升级到最新的4.2.1版本Juno,采用离线安装ADT 20.03版时,提示Cannot complete the install because one or more required items could not be found. Software being installed: Android Native Development Tools 20.0.3原创 2012-10-27 13:43:02 · 4784 阅读 · 2 评论 -
Android开发: strings.xml文件中的错误
编辑strings.xml的时候在行http://code.dd.com/rr?q=%rr.55提示下面的错误Multiple annotations found at this line:- error: Multiple substitutions specified in non-positional format; did you mean to add the for原创 2012-10-08 09:00:42 · 4326 阅读 · 0 评论 -
Android开发: 启动Android 4.0模拟器提示的错误
今天通过AVD Manager无法创建成功关于Android 4.0的Virtual Device, 提示'Unable to find a 'userdata.img' file for ABI armeabi to copy into the AVD folder. '的错误,查了一下帮助发现,Android 4.0以上的模拟器需要ARM EABI System Image的支持,通过An原创 2012-10-08 09:06:59 · 865 阅读 · 0 评论 -
Android开发: 获得某一个类型文件的打开方式
获得文件的打开方式的Action是Intent.ACTION_GET_CONTENT示例:Intent audioIntent = new Intent(Intent.ACTION_GET_CONTENT); audioIntent.setType("audio/*");startActivity(Intent.createChooser(audioIntent, "选择音频程序原创 2012-10-08 09:03:40 · 1398 阅读 · 0 评论 -
关于PHP中strpos的问题
strpos是用来在一个字符串中查找另外一个或多个字符串代码:$str1='ext-gen1226';$str2='ext';//echo strpos($str1,str2,0);if(strpos($str1,str2,0)==false){ echo'AAA';}else{ echo'BBB';}结果: AAA按正常应该输出为BBB原创 2012-10-07 11:02:22 · 1473 阅读 · 0 评论 -
Android开发: 调试输出
利用Android提供的logcat工具,eclipse中已经集成了logcat,如下如果没有看到logcat,可以通过 菜单 Windows -> Show View ->Other -> Android -> LogCat 来打开。程序日志输出语句,不用类型的日志,输出时会以不同颜色表示Log.v(String tag, String msg); //verbose类型日志,原创 2013-03-04 21:15:49 · 11401 阅读 · 0 评论 -
Android开发中的一些技巧记录
1.快捷键ctrl + / 快速注释当前行或者所选择的多行代码alt + / 对当前光标所在位置的代码输入提示f3 跳转至代码定义处ctrl + f 当前文档查找ctrl + h 当前工程或整个workspace搜索f2 获得光标所在位置的方法或类的Help档2. //定义一个数字格式化对象,格式化模板为".##",即保留2位小数. Deci原创 2012-10-07 10:59:18 · 592 阅读 · 0 评论 -
Android开发:设置TextView的颜色的简便方法
动态创建TextView需要设置字体颜色,有很多种方法设置tv.setTextColor(android.graphics.Color.parseColor("#1662B0"));这种方法是最简便的,颜色值形式跟布局里的一样原创 2013-05-20 15:26:20 · 959 阅读 · 2 评论 -
Android开发:Android Studio的中文问题
Android Studio安装后发现所有的中文,不管是界面上的还是输出的log中的中文都变成小框框可以肯定是字体的问题解决:菜单File->settings对话框,切换到Appearance标签选择override default fonts by, 先随便选择一个中文字体(PS:小框框都是中文字 呵呵),保存,重启软件,即可。来自东子哥的Blog原创 2013-05-18 01:16:55 · 2046 阅读 · 0 评论 -
Android开发:获得文件大小方式
方式一、java.io.File file = new File(“文件路径”);long fileL = file.length();方式二、File dF = new File(“文件路径”);FileInputStream fis;fis = new FileInputStream(dF);int fileL = fis.available();原创 2013-04-19 12:58:27 · 1322 阅读 · 0 评论